I bought the DLO hipcase when I purchased my iPhone from an AT&T store on June 30th. For the most part it's a good design with one grave exception that ultimately ended up costing me $249. Those exposed corners are killer. Due to my poor design (I'm somewhat obese) the case would occasionally pop off of my belt. The drop usually resulted in a corner striking pavement or cement. Eventually the upper right corner of my iPhone sustained enough damage that the frame surrounding the sleep button bent to the point where it "permanently" depressed the sleep/wake button, putting my iPhone at the mercy of it's software to sleep it. Battery life suffered and I had no choice but to send it into Apple's repair depot. Why $249? That's Apple's standard repair fee, I suspect because it covers the cost of replacement (which they did, I now have a different but brand new [?] iPhone)
